GUWAHATI: Assam and Meghalaya have recorded the highest June rainfall in 121 years with 858.1 mm, breaking the earlier record of 789.5 mm recorded in 1966, as reported by the climate summary for June prepared by the India Meteorological Department (IMD), which was released on Wednesday, July 6.
The average maximum, minimum and mean temperature for the country as a whole during June 2022 were 34.12 degrees Celsius, 25.06 degrees Celsius and 29.59 degrees Celsius respectively, against the normal of 33.73 degrees Celsius, 24.76 degrees Celsius and 29.25 degrees celsius based on the period of 1981-2010.
Thus, the average maximum, average minimum temperature and mean temperature have drastically increased by 0.40 degrees Celsius, 0.29 degrees Celsius, 0.35 degrees Celsius respectively for the entire country.
